描述
Litematica 是一款现代原理图模组,主要面向轻量级模组加载器,例如 MC 1.12.x 的 LiteLoader、MC 1.13.x 的 Rift,以及 MC 1.14+ 的 Fabric。
此外也有 Forge 版本,但目前仅支持 MC 1.12.2。对于之后的 MC 版本,目前只有第三方移植版本,例如 Forgematica。
Litematica 拥有旧版 Schematica 模组的所有主要功能(以及更多额外功能),唯一不包含的是 printer 功能。这个功能并不计划直接加入 Litematica 本体,而是留给扩展模组来实现(参见:aria1th printer 或 the other printer)。
与着色器的兼容性
Litematica 的渲染目前在 1.21.3+ 中无法与着色器正常兼容(即使使用 Iris 也是如此)。因此当你需要使用 Litematica(原理图渲染)时,请禁用着色器。
在较旧的 MC 版本中,渲染与着色器的兼容性更好一些,至少对 Iris 来说是这样,不过也取决于具体的光影包。有些光影包会把渲染效果破坏得很严重,但也有些曾经能很好地工作。总体来说,Optifine 一直/曾经更加容易出问题;如果你在使用 Litematica,那么基本上无法同时在 Optifine 下使用着色器。通常建议使用 Sodium(以及 Iris)来代替 Optifine。
快捷键
打开 Litematica 主菜单的默认快捷键是 M。
注意:如果你使用的不是 QWERTY 键盘布局,那么按键可能会不同,例如在 AZERTY 上 M 可能会变成 ,。
其他常见默认快捷键:
-
M + C - 直接打开配置菜单的快捷键
-
M + R - 开启/关闭 Litematica 的所有渲染
-
M + G - 开启/关闭仅原理图渲染(“ghost blocks/幽灵方块”——例如所有 HUD 仍会继续渲染)
-
M + T - 开启/关闭“tool item/工具物品”(默认是一根木棍)的功能
-
M + P - 直接打开原理图放置菜单/列表
-
M + V - 打开原理图校验器菜单
-
Numpad minus - 为当前选中的放置打开放置配置菜单
-
Numpad multiply - 打开区域编辑器菜单
-
Page Up/Down - 在渲染层设置中切换当前选中层
-
M + Page Up/Down - 切换渲染层模式
-
Ctrl + scroll(手持工具时) - 循环切换“工具模式”(主菜单左下角也有对应按钮)
-
Alt + scroll(手持工具时) - 沿玩家视线方向微调/移动当前选中的放置、区域选择框或角点(具体取决于工具模式)
-
Ctrl + M - 切换或循环某些“工具模式”的“子模式”或主要设置,例如粘贴模式中的 pasteReplaceBehavior、区域选择模式中的 Corners 与 Expand 行为,或删除模式中的 Area 与 Placement 行为
多人游戏警告
Easy Place 模式功能可能会导致你在某些服务器上被封禁!
Easy Place 功能总是会点击目标位置的空气方块,而这一点很容易被反作弊系统检测到。因此至少可能产生两种结果:方块放置会被直接拒绝,你只会看到客户端侧的幽灵方块;或者某些反作弊系统会将其判定为作弊,并自动将你从服务器封禁。所以在使用 Easy Place 之前,请先确认服务器是否允许这样做!
如果你安装了 Optifine...
总体来说,我不推荐使用 Optifine(无论是否搭配 Litematica),因为它会导致各种渲染问题。如果你想使用着色器,我更推荐使用 Sodium 和/或 Iris。
如果你安装了 Optifine,那么你很可能需要在 Optifine 中禁用一些选项,否则它会破坏原理图渲染:
- 如果你看到故障般的奇怪三角形,那么在 1.16+ 中请先尝试更新到最新版本的 Litematica。如果仍然无效,请将 shaders 设置为
OFF(不是 Internal),然后重启游戏。
-
Render Regions 很可能需要禁用,以防止奇怪的渲染问题(例如原理图部分内容渲染到奇怪的位置)
- 如果仍然存在一些奇怪的 HUD/GUI 渲染问题,
Fast Render 也可能需要禁用
文档
这里有一个 wiki。该 wiki 仍在编写中,之后它很可能会迁移到新地址(或者说会有一个位于新位置、覆盖内容更多的新 wiki)。
其他/较旧的文档与说明,以及一些常见问题解答
这里有一篇 Reddit 帖子,解释了这个模组最基础的用法:
- https://old.reddit.com/r/Minecraft/comments/cqdmkk/anyonecanhelpmehowdoimakeschematics_with/exeug78/
Litematica - 服务器上的 Easy Place 支持
- https://old.reddit.com/r/litematica/comments/1c7j79l/easyplaceon_server/l0hzmkt/
Reddit 或我的 Discord 服务器上的一些杂项说明
原理图格式转换:
- https://old.reddit.com/r/Minecraft/comments/oabwea/schemfilesworkinlitematicabutschematic/h3ju3sy/
Litematica 带子区域的 Normal 选择模式:
- https://old.reddit.com/r/feedthebeast/comments/r9n9mi/litematicasaddselectionboxkeybindwontwork/
- https://old.reddit.com/r/feedthebeast/comments/r9n9mi/litematicasaddselectionboxkeybindwontwork/hnpe9yg/
Litematica - 隐藏一个区域选择:
- https://github.com/maruohon/litematica/discussions/755#discussioncomment-6772682
- https://old.reddit.com/r/fabricmc/comments/yw9r5y/litematica1192issues/ixr7l5h/
Litematica - 无法创建新的选择子区域(在 Simple 模式下):
- https://www.curseforge.com/minecraft/mc-mods/litematica?comment=2694
Litematica - Normal/Multi-Region 区域选择教程:
- https://github.com/maruohon/litematica/issues/716#issuecomment-1596121219
Litematica - 在带有 FabricCarpet 但没有 CarpetExtra 的服务器上使用 Easy Place:
- https://discord.com/channels/169369095538606080/566649314001158165/1235158483792433214
- https://discord.com/channels/169369095538606080/566649314001158165/1221223833889935420
Litematica - easy/fast selections 教程:
- https://discord.com/channels/169369095538606080/566649314001158165/1187372903377936435
Litematica - 原理图格式:
- https://discord.com/channels/169369095538606080/183172448919748608/1180841121845354516
- https://discord.com/channels/169369095538606080/566649314001158165/1176569283271213098
- https://discord.com/channels/169369095538606080/566649314001158165/1097540707931127938
- https://discord.com/channels/169369095538606080/169369095538606080/1081089742944337941
- https://discord.com/channels/169369095538606080/566649314001158165/1097564948999184394
- https://github.com/maruohon/litematica/issues/812#issuecomment-1924300257
Litematica - 保存和粘贴带有方块实体数据的内容:
- https://discord.com/channels/169369095538606080/566649314001158165/1193304174838960200
Litematica - Material Lists 的变体:
- https://www.reddit.com/r/litematica/comments/15yz2bo/materiallistnotshowingup/jxfiwvh/
Litematica - Manual Origin 问题:
- https://github.com/maruohon/litematica/issues/751#issuecomment-1671611897
Litematica - 正确放置楼梯:
- https://github.com/maruohon/litematica/issues/797#issuecomment-1848386879
Litematica - 大型原理图的性能优化建议:
- https://discord.com/channels/169369095538606080/566649314001158165/1186744945399320647
Litematica - 大型原理图、性能差或崩溃时该怎么办:
- https://discord.com/channels/169369095538606080/566649314001158165/1122755969651318894
Litematica - 如何一次只显示一种方块类型:
- https://discord.com/channels/169369095538606080/566649314001158165/1133702185121755258
Litematica 无法工作/按键无效:
- https://discord.com/channels/169369095538606080/566649314001158165/1196124302634922075
Litematica “only render one block”:
- https://discord.com/channels/169369095538606080/566649314001158165/1061881509579075684
Litematica - 查找 schematics 目录/游戏目录:
- https://old.reddit.com/r/litematica/comments/1co6vh4/downloadingschematicsondifferentversions_of/l3c21l9/
- https://old.reddit.com/r/litematica/comments/13es48n/howtoimportschematicson_mac/kb8bu5d/
Litematica - 使用子区域:
- https://github.com/maruohon/litematica/discussions/647
Litematica - 在服务器上粘贴红石:
- https://discord.com/channels/169369095538606080/566649314001158165/1063578995347685446
- https://legacy.curseforge.com/minecraft/mc-mods/litematica?comment=2838
- https://discord.com/channels/169369095538606080/566649314001158165/1227276878830764183
Litematica - 在服务器上粘贴物品栏内容,含 Litemoretica:
- https://old.reddit.com/r/litematica/comments/1cg186f/itemswonttransfer/
Litematica - 粘贴任务不运行 + 相对全面的 mspt 与性能分析快速指南:
- https://github.com/maruohon/litematica/issues/656
Litematica - 原理图放置说明:
- https://github.com/maruohon/litematica/issues/703#issuecomment-1553132401
Litematica - 材料列表:
- https://discord.com/channels/169369095538606080/566649314001158165/1071408321417973780
Litematica - 大型原理图的性能优化建议:
- https://discord.com/channels/169369095538606080/566649314001158165/1198321606536200324
Litematica - .minecraft 目录中没有 schematics 文件夹:
- https://www.reddit.com/r/fabricmc/comments/jn8u5d/howdoiaddaschematicforlitematicto_load/jhk6941/
Litematica “not working”(不在 Controls 中) -> F3、malilib 按键、Mod Menu:
- https://discord.com/channels/169369095538606080/169369095538606080/1197972330958295110
World Edit 粘贴:
- https://old.reddit.com/r/technicalminecraft/comments/j9ipu1/howcaniloadaschemfilethati_downloaded/g8k49xj/
MacOS 中如何返回上一级目录:
- https://discord.com/channels/169369095538606080/1135325334565298237/1186539038572822618
Youtube 教程
这里列出了一些我遇到过的较好的 Youtube 教程视频。
Youtube 教程